Chuck Prophet rings in new album with fall dates
With a month-long European tour recently wrapped, indie-rocker Chuck Prophet will soon embark on a North American leg behind his new studio effort, "Let Freedom Ring."
The US trek, which begins with a Nov. 6 performance in Winters, CA, will stop by clubs and theaters in 22 cities throughout the nation. The outing concludes with a Dec. 12 concert in Eugene, OR. Details are shown below.
The roadwork will be a family affair, as Prophet will be backed by The Mission Express, a four-piece band which is helmed by his wife, singer/keyboardist Stephanie Finch, and features Kevin White on bass, Todd Roper on drums and James DePrato on guitar.
"Let Freedom Ring," Prophet's latest studio set, hit shelves Tuesday (10/27). The new album--a "collection of political songs for non-political people," according to a statement posted at his website--follows the singer/guitarist's 2007 release, "Dreaming Waylon's Dreams."
Prophet recorded the 11-track effort with guitarist Tom Ayres, bassist Rusty Miller and drummer Ernest "Boom" Carter over an eight-day session in Mexico City earlier this year.
Three songs for "Let Freedom Ring," including the title track, are currently streaming at Prophet's MySpace page.
